I have been keeping wild discus now for a while.. but recently have dove head first in and I am starting to get a bit of a collection. I kept domestics years ago even breeding them etc but lost interest pretty quickly. These wilds are way more fascinating to me (and challenging! every time I think I have it down something new happens) it is so cool to see the different colors the fish exhibit - even the same fish with different moods. And kinda understand where the domestic strains developed from. The other thing I have found is they are more cichlidy- meaning they have bigger personalities and more aggression. Below are some random shots- some I know the collection point some I do not. But I plan on adding as I go along to try to keep track of there development . Feel free to comment or ask any questions.

Wow! :D Wilds sound so interesting. Could you give us a rundown on the tank set up?? :)
Sure- it is 110 gallon tank with a bio tower drip filter into a small sump- with a 9 watt uv and an eheim 2250- ton of drift wood and some java moss and dwarf water lettuce (thanks mrrobxc mrrobxc ) there are submerged pothos and peace lillys coming out of the top of the tank. Livestock consists of ten discus ( a couple more arriving this week) 2 half black veil angels 6 corydoras crypticus some queen arabasque plecos and the baby lei and a small albino irridescent shark (the last 2 are short timers untl they get some size.
